Robotics in Genito-Urinary Surgery fills the void of information on robotic urological surgery; a topic that is currently highly in demand and continuously increasing. This book provides detailed information on the utility of robotic urological surgery and how to use it most effectively.  Robotics i...

Auteur(s) du livre


Ashok K. Hemal, MS, DipNB, MCh, MAMS, FICS, FACS, FAMS, FRCS (Glasg): Professor, Department of Urology, Director, Robotics and Minimally Invasive Surgery, Wake Forest University School of Medicine, Wake Forest University Health Sciences, Medical Center Boulevard, Winston-Salem, NC. Dr Hemal has also contributed to several robotic programs worldwide.Dr. Mani Menon, MD: the Director of Vattikuti Urology Institute, Chairman of Urology at the Henry Ford Health System in Detroit is a well known figure in urologic academia for many years. He is widely published and renowned for his impeccable literary style. As the pioneer of robotic radical prostatectomy - did the first major study to compare open and robotic prostatectomies, published in the BJU Ints in 2003 - he has performed the largest number of such surgeries and has published his impressive results in the Journal of Urology and BJU Intl. He has also organized international workshops on robotic urology and made many presentations on this topic.
